It was a bold notion to name a magazine LIFE. The word life, after all, encompasses everything. The major events that define generations, the fleeting moments that comprise the everyday, the feelings we have and the world we inhabit. As a weekly magazine LIFE covered it all, with a breadth and open-mindedness that looks especially astounding today, when publications and websites tailor their ...

Accomplishments are positive changes and value creation that you have produced with effort and initiative. This includes business, professional, academic and personal efforts that produced mostly positive outcomes.
An accomplishment is something remarkable that has been done or achieved. For a novelist, that's quite an accomplishment. By any standards, the accomplishments of the past year are extraordinary. Your accomplishments are the things that you can do well or the important things that you have done.
